Real-time GPS streams to the dispatch board over WebSocket; pin position updates land in the customer-facing app simultaneously so passengers see live driver progress. Offline tolerance is first-class: when drivers lose signal, the app queues GPS pings and job-state events locally; on reconnection, the queue flushes in order to maintain a continuous trail. This matters for areas with unreliable coverage, motorway stretches between cities, and underground stations.
